PGA Championship Launches With New Campaign By The Reactor

The PGA Championship, one the Australia’s biggest golf tournaments and Held at the RACV Royal Pines on the Gold Coast in December, is set to attract some of the best local and international golf stars.

The Reactor has been working with the PGA to give the tournament a fresh new look, showing the vast array of activities for more than just the golf enthusiasts at this huge three-day event.

The PGA wanted to demonstrate that while the PGA Championship is an important event in the PGA tour calendar, it’s one that everyone can enjoy. They wanted to show how they have broadened their offering for 2015 by including lots of family friendly, dining and entertainment activities into the three days of this premier golf tournament.

The Reactor MD Phil Childs said, “The creative is very different to how golf events are often positioned.”

The “Where Everyone Plays” theme and vibrant imagery positions the PGA Championship as more than just a major golf tournament. It’s a place where the whole family can hang out, enjoy the Gold Coast sun while watching some of the greats play while also enjoying other event activities”

The campaign will run from October to December 2015 in outdoor, online, on-course and print.
